  1. Robert Singer was a writer, director and producer of the series Supernatural. Singer had been working on the show in a co-showrunner capacity since Season 1. He was often credited for a lot of Dean's one liners and is married to writer Eugenie Ross-Leming.

  2. Robert Singer (born December 3) is an American television producer, director and writer. He is known for his work on Supernatural where he served as an executive producer, director and occasional writer. The character Bobby Singer was named after him.

  4. May 27, 2024 · Bob Singer is a director, writer and executive producer on Supernatural. Singer has been working on the show in a co-showrunner capacity since season 1. For season 11, Singer took a step back from the show, taking on a consulting producer position. With season 12, Singer returned to executive producer/showrunner duties alongside Andrew Dabb .
